Sylvia M. Ramos M.D., M.S., F.A. C.S.
Dr. Sylvia M. Ramos has been a board-certified and recertified general surgeon since 1980. She has specialized in the diagnosis, management and surgery of benign and malignant breast diseases since 1995 and for many years was the only surgeon in New Mexico who devoted her practice completely to patients affected by those conditions. She also has had a special interest in the management of lymphedema, especially when it occurs after the treatment of breast cancer. Throughout her career Dr. Ramos has been active in professional and community organizations that address the physical psychological and societal needs of patients with breast cancer including those belonging to underserved and minority populations. Edna Lopez, CFNP
Edna is a graduate of the University of New Mexico Family Nurse Practitioner program. She is board certified in Family practice by the American Nurses Credentialing Center, and has a Masters degree in Nursing. Prior to working with Dr. Seedman, Edna worked in family practice, urgent care, the Emergency room and also did outreach for Healthcare for the Homeless.
Edna works in collaborative practice with Dr. Susan Seedman. She assesses the physical, psychological, and social needs of her patients. Following her assessment, Edna then consults with Dr. Seedman, and together a care plan is designed for the patient with desired outcomes. Edna monitors patient care, and traiges needed services for the patient while ensuring proper access to these services. In addition, she extends help to the family to learn caregiving skills, and patient self-care skills. The desired results are to increase patient satisfaction, reduce the cost of care and to enhance patient outcomes.
Who We Are
Breast Specialty Care is a complete care practice devoted to the diagnosis, management and treatment of persons with benign and malignant diseases of the breast and lymphedema.
Our Services
- Evaluation, monitoring and surgery for benign and malignant breast conditions
- Breast cancer risk evaluation and monitoring
- Evaluation, monitoring, management and treatment of lymphedema
- Breast ultrasound evaluations
- Ultrasound guided biopsy procedures
- Mammosite placement for radiation treatments
- Cryosurgery
- Lymphedema determinations using Imp XCA L-Dex index
